A Fitful Dream is the posthumously published memoir of Mokwugo Okoye, a Nigerian writer, activist, and public intellectual whose life was bound up with the struggle for independence and the early formation of modern Nigeria.

Spanning childhood in rural Nigeria, wartime upheaval, public service, political engagement, imprisonment, and later intellectual life, the memoir traces a life shaped by conviction and consequence. A prominent voice in Nigeria's independence movement and an influential participant in the nation’s early political life, Mokwugo Okoye witnessed and helped shape some of the defining events of modern Nigerian history. In recognition of his contributions, he was awarded an honorary Doctor of Letters (D.Litt) by the University of Nigeria, Nsukka in 1985.Moving between personal memory and historical change, the book offers both an intimate account of lived experience and a broader reflection on a turbulent period in the nation’s history.

A Fitful Dream offers a rare firsthand perspective on some of the defining events, ideas, and debates that shaped twentieth-century Nigeria. Written with candour, intellectual curiosity, and a deep sense of public responsibility, the memoir brings together personal experience and historical reflection in a single narrative.More than a record of one life, the book provides insight into the aspirations, struggles, and contradictions of a generation that witnessed colonial rule, independence, and the challenges of nation-building. It will be of interest to readers of history, politics, biography, African studies, and anyone seeking a deeper understanding of modern Nigeria.
